Supernatural
 
We used to be crazy about Supernatural, but somewhere along the line, are interest waned, and I've missed out on the last few seasons. The latest episode has renewed my love for this show. The episode is called Scoobynatural. The Winchesters get sucked into the cartoon. Awesomeness happens.

Of course, I had to go back and watch the Supernatural Convention, French Mistake, and other great episodes.

What would some of your suggestions be for must-see episodes?

PuYang 03-30-2018 03:22 PM

I don't know the titles for each episode, but the one where Sam is trapped in a time loop by Loki/Gabriel (I can't remember if he is Gabriel? or some other angel). Sam has to watch Dean die over and over in weird ways was a fairly funny episode. (I think this was somewhere before end of Season 5)

Another fun episode was where they find out they are in a TV show and kinda breaks the fourth wall. (This was after Season 5 when the show went downhill)
